Good afternoon,
I'm workin' with a Davis Vantage vue under cumulusMX. Since I enabled cumulusmx, when it's rainy, the "today's rain" data is bad.Let me show You a real example :

Yesterday was rainy and my vue console registered 6.2 mm. I resetted the equipment so this data is new. But when I've seen today's data, CumulusMX shows 6.2mm Rain data for today and for yesterday so it shows 12.4mm of rain.

Could somebody tell me what I've to do? Many thanks. Regards.
